Multistate Retailer- Companies that sell merchandise on a multistate basis are under increased audit by states as they continue to look for unregistered businesses. Even wholesalers are under increased pressure to register and file in states even though no sales tax may be due on the sales they make. This assessment tool is designed to help companies identify nexus creating activities and assess whether they have some historical risk for failing to be in compliance with the sales tax rules in other states.

Multistate Service Providers- The sales tax compliance requirements for multistate service companies are complex. Many companies may not know that they a responsibility to collect and remit tax on the services they provide. This may include data processing, staffing, debt collection, installation, and repair services as just examples. Answering this assessment tool honestly will give you insight into any multistate tax obligations your company may have related to the services you provide.

Multistate Technology Companies- This assessment tool is designed to help technology companies identify the critical issues requiring them to comply with the sales tax rules in multiple states. This includes companies that sell software, hardware, provide data processing services, provide SaaS, IaaS, or PaaS, electronic information services, or any other services that utilize technology as a central component of the service delivery.

Multistate Contractor Services- Multistate contractors are aggressively targeted by states to ensure that they are in compliance with the sales tax rules in their states. In many cases, companies that may classify themselves as contractors may actually be retailers or "dual operators" which can have a very unique set of tax rules for them to follow. This assessment tool is designed to help companies that are involved with the affixation of tangible property to real property understand what type of sales tax issues they may have as they operate in multiple states.

Multistate Wholesales and Distribution Companies- Wholesale and distribution companies often take a passive approach to multistate sales tax compliance. As states look for additional revenue, wholesalers are finding themselves under audit and oftentimes surprised to find they have a large problem. This assessment tool is designed whether your company has nexus in other states and if there are weaknesses in your exemption certificate documentation.
